In 2008, the Lumina Foundation, a national private foundation focused on higher education and workforce development, set a national attainment goal that by 2025 60% of working-age adults would earn college degrees, certificates or industry-recognized certifications.

Image: Harvard University announced its 30th president Thursday, drawing from within to hire Claudine Gay, the first Black president in the institution’s nearly 400-year history. JoAnne Epps was named Temple University’s acting president , the Board of Trustees announced Tuesday. Epps was appointed dean of Temple Beasley School of Law in 2008 and named provost in 2016.
